biobarThe biobar project is a bioinformatics power-browsing toolbar for Mozilla-based browsers. This toolbar provides access to major biological data resources. The primary advantage of this tool is that it allows a biologist to browse and retrieve data from Genomic, Proteomic, Functional, Literature, Taxonomic, Structural, Plant and Animal-specific databases. In addition to the browsing features, biobar also provides links to important bioinformatics sites and services including services at the European Bioinformatics Institute (EBI), National Center for Biotechnology Information (NCBI) and DNA Data Bank of Japan (DDBJ). The tool also provides links to major data deposition sites for nucleotide, protein and 3D-structure data. Finally, the menu also contains links to many Sequence, Structure alignment and analysis tools.

With version 1.3 of biobar it is possible to customize the search menu of the toolbar. The procedure involves editing an XML file and saving the file in your profile directory.

LSDTLife Science Dictionary Tool is a Mouseover dictionary that can translate vast numbers of life science terms. 93,000 English terms and 105,000 Japanese terms available with examples and gene information collected from life science dictionary project.

Features

  • Word dictionary – It will immediately pop up the meaning, related terms and example sentences when putting a mouse over the unknowing technical terms and names,
  • Translates phrases! – Immediately translate phrases made with multiple words!
  • Key combination – Translation operates only when holding down with selected key combination.
  • Range selecting translation – When multiple numbers of phrases match, you can select one term and translate individually. Available when using key combination function.
  • Change highlight color – You can change the highlight color of the matched term in the dictionary.

wired-markerWired-Marker is a permanent (indelible) highlighter that you use on Web pages. The highlighter, which comes in various colors and styles, is a kind of electronic bookmark that serves as a guide when you revisit a Web page. The highlighted content is automatically recorded in a scrapbook and saved.
Wired-Marker is a freeware that was developed as part of the Integrated Database Project sponsored by the Ministry of Education, Culture, Sports, Science and Technology (development code name: ScrapParty) for supporting the construction of databases.
